A rectangular farm has an area of 1/5 square miles. If its length is 2/3 miles, what is its width? Input your answer as a fraction.

Hey! Let's start off with the equation for the area of a rectangle:


A=lw

Subsitute in the values we already know:


(1)/(5)=(2)/(3)w

To find the width, we need to isolate
w on one side of the equals sign. We can do this by dividing both sides of the equation by
(2)/(3):


(1)/(5)/(2)/(3)=w

To divide fractions, multiply the dividend by the divisor's reciprocal (flip the numbers) and simplify:


\begin{aligned}(1)/(5)*(3)/(2)&=w\\(1*3)/(5*2)&=w\\(3)/(10)&=w\\w&=\boxed{(3)/(10)}\end{aligned}
